Winter adventures at Chester Zoo
Home to over 30,000 animals, Chester Zoo invites you to explore, unwind and reconnect this winter – with nature, each other and yourself.
Explore 130 acres of immersive habitats - from dense rainforests and tropical caves to open wetlands and Himalayan mountains. Don’t forget to visit the spectacular new Heart of Africa. Inspired by African landscapes, species and culture, it brings giraffes, African wild dogs, warthogs and more in a space that replicates the African savannah – designed to connect you with the wonders of the natural world.

Designed with families in mind
Young adventurers can take on the Treetop Challenge or drive all-electric off-road vehicles. There’s also face painting, fairground rides and five epic playgrounds across the zoo packed with climbing nets, water play, giant slides and sand pits.
For a slower pace, wander through award-winning gardens, with sensory-friendly spaces, Changing Places facilities, and mobility scooter hire to help everyone enjoy their day.
Refuel your adventure
From sizzling street food to relaxed family lunches, there’s something for every appetite. Visitors can grab fresh food from kiosks and cafés, or take a break at The Oakfield, the zoo’s Grade II listed pub with garden views.
You’ll find vegan, vegetarian, gluten-free, and kid-friendly options, plus picnic spots and shaded areas.

Easy to get to. Easy to get around.
Chester Zoo is just a short bus ride from Chester Train Station. There’s free on-site parking, including dedicated EV charging spaces, and step-free access throughout the zoo.
Visitors can download the free Chester Zoo app for live talk times, maps, animal facts and more.
A day out that gives back
Chester Zoo is a not-for-profit conservation zoo. Every ticket, meal, and souvenir helps fund projects that protect wildlife in the UK and across more than 20 countries. That makes a day out here not just memorable, but meaningful too.
